Super Six short term picks for January 24

Hemen Kapadia of KR Choksey Securities suggests buying Glenmark Pharma with a target of Rs 516 and Jindal Steel & Power with a target of Rs 273.

January 24, 2014 / 08:50 IST

On CNBC-TV18's show Super Six, market gurus Vishal Kshatriya of Edelweiss, Meghana Malkan of malkansview.com and Hemen Kapadia of KR Choksey Securities share, place their bets on two stocks each, thus offering investors a variety of options to choose from. Investors can read into the detailed analysis before agreeing to any or all the bets.

Vishal Kshatriya of Edelweiss

Buy Tata Communications with a stoploss at Rs 290 and target of Rs 335.

Buy Apollo Tyres with a stoploss at Rs 110 and target of Rs 121.

Meghana Malkan of malkansview.com

Buy Adani Enterprises with a stoploss at Rs 252 and target of Rs 266.

Buy Grasim Industries with a stoploss at Rs 2570 and target of Rs 2660.

Hemen Kapadia of KR Choksey Securities

Buy Glenmark Pharma with a stoploss at Rs 504 and target of Rs 516.

Buy Jindal Steel & Power with a stoploss at Rs 264 and target of Rs 273.
